Extraction of the essential features from massive bands is a key issue in hyperspectral images classification. Plenty of feature extraction techniques can be found in the literature but most of these methods rely on the linear/stationary assumptions. Climate is a nonlinear system, and the BP neural network algorithm or the Support Vector Machine (SVM) algorithm which is superior in dealing with nonlinear problems is usually used in the climate forecast. Decision tree support vector machine (DTSVM), which combines SVM and decision tree using the concept of dichotomy, is proposed to solve the multi-class fault diagnosis tasks.
